Operations Management Inspects New Batch of Tractor Heads to Enhance Operational Efficiency

As part of the company’s development program, the team formed by Operations Management visited the headquarters of Idri Company in Misrata, the agent of IVECO, to inspect 10 new tractor heads contracted for supply to the Joint Libya Oil Company. These equipment will be transported to the company’s warehouses in the coming days to enhance operational capabilities and support the company’s activities in various regions, contributing to improved performance and increased operational efficiency.

Tanker VS Spirit Docks at Tripoli Seaport with Over 30 Million Liters of Gasoline

On Friday’s evening , August 30, 2024, the tanker VS Spirit docked at the Tripoli seaport, carrying more than thirty million liters of gasoline. Starting tonight, gasoline will be pumped to all fuel stations equally. In just a few hours, all the congestion at fuel stations will end.
